Proposed Project 1 Financial Summary of Obligation and Expenditure of Block Grant Funds (45 CFR 96.30)-0990-0236-Public Law 101-510 amended 31 U.S.C. Chapter 15 to provide that, by the end of the fifth fiscal year after the fiscal year in which the Federal government obligated the funds, the account will be canceled. If valid charges to a canceled account are presented after cancellation, they may be honored only by charging them to a current appropriation account, not to exceed an amount equal to 1 percent of the total appropriations of that account. Because of the need to determine the status of grant accounts to comply with this statutory provision, we have determined that it is appropriate to require an annual report on obligations and/or expenditures from all grantees under the block grant programs. *Respondents:* State, local or tribal Government. *Reporting Burden Information:* *Number of Respondents:* 620; *Annual Frequency of Response:* one time; *Average Burden per Response:* one hour; *Total Annual Burden:* 620 hours.
